Output 37e26637f2e4df1fa50cdb72a9ec42edd96954a0e4ca877cdf584a2b5e8af373:17

value
31366117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ed4c8abe4b27f366fa22bac0e232552855e8096 OP_EQUAL
address
3GAqbLRLZcerxTC4r8EK7EMk6us7WDonKx
transaction
37e26637f2e4df1fa50cdb72a9ec42edd96954a0e4ca877cdf584a2b5e8af373
spent
true